The Imperative for Advanced Simulation in Modern Aviation
As commercial and private aviation markets expand, with projected global passenger volumes reaching 8.2 billion by 2025 (Airline Data & Industry Trends, 2023), the necessity for high-fidelity training tools becomes increasingly urgent. These tools are not only designed to improve pilot competence but also to preemptively identify and mitigate risks associated with complex flight scenarios.
Traditional training methods, while foundational, often struggle to replicate the nuanced, real-time decision-making required in emergency or unusual situations. Herein lies the transformative potential of advanced flight simulation solutions, which incorporate the latest in visual realism, real-time data integration, and scenario customization.
Technological Innovations Driving Simulation Capabilities
| Technological Aspect | Industry Impact | Example |
|---|---|---|
| Visual Fidelity | Enhanced training realism improves pilot immersion and situational awareness. | Ultra-high-definition graphics with night vision and weather effects. |
| Data Integration | Allows scenario customization based on real-world operational data; performance analytics. | Use of recent flight data to simulate specific weather patterns or equipment failures. |
| Hardware Innovation | Increased fidelity with motion platforms, haptic feedback, and surround sound. | Full-motion simulators that mimic G-forces during high-speed maneuvers. |
| Artificial Intelligence | Dynamic scenario adaptation and autonomous environmental responses. | Simulators that adjust difficulty based on pilot proficiency or introduce unpredictable variables. |
Industry Leaders and Adoption Trends
Major aircraft manufacturers such as Boeing and Airbus are integrating these technological advances to develop comprehensive simulation suites. For instance, the Airbus A350 flight training program emphasizes scenario-based learning supported by high-definition virtual environments, reducing real aircraft time by up to 30% (Aviation Week, 2022).
Furthermore, Republic Airways’ recent adoption of advanced simulators exemplifies industry confidence in these tools for initial pilot training and recurrent exercises, aligning with ICAO's safety enhancement initiatives.

Future Trends and Challenges
Looking ahead, the ongoing convergence of artificial intelligence, machine learning, and virtual reality promises to craft even more immersive, adaptive, and cost-effective training environments. However, challenges remain—chiefly, ensuring equitable access to these advanced systems, managing high implementation costs, and maintaining alignment with regulatory requirements.
